WILLGERODT, Hans was born in 1924 in Hildesheim, Germany.

Diplom-Volkswirt, Doctorate, Habilitation, Privatdozent University Bonn,1950,1954, 1959.
Professor, Director, Institute, Institution Wirtschaftspolitik, University Cologne, 1963, 1970. Director, Wirschaftspolitisches Seminar, University Cologne, West. Germany, since 1963. Editorial Boards, ORDOYearbook, Zeitschrift für Wirtschaftspolitik.
Problems created when using trade barriers as a means of balance-of-payments policy. International monetary order: early analysis and prediction of the economic and politial difficulties of a monetary union of the European Economie Community. Proof that convertibility and flexible exchange rates reduce the alleged danger of petro-dollars and political fund transfers.
New international economic order: criticism of the Corea-Plan and the report of the NorthSouth Commission. In contrast a liberal economic order is advocated. Proposi
tion of a supply-side policy to fight stagflation and rejection of Keynesian instruments.
Recommendation to foster private property as a basic element of a sound economic and political order. Critical analysis of the European agriculture policy.
